Herbaria
Date Published: Sep 10, 2024
Special screening of the film Herbaria at the Screening Room, organized by the Vulnerable Media Lab. Herbaria is a poetic documentary that parallels the rigorous and vital practices of botanical preservation and film preservation, blending 16mm and archival footage.
Quamajuq, Glenn Gear Exhibition
Date Published: Apr 03, 2023
Quamajuq is a first-of-its-kind gallery for Inuit art and culture in the heart of downtown Winnipeg. The large-scale installation commissioned for the exhibit was created by Glenn Gear, a multi-disciplinary artist and filmmaker of mixed Inuit-Settler ancestry.

Activating Cultural Archives for Marginalized Communities
Date Published: Jan 05, 2023
VML is dedicated to activating and remediating audiovisual archives created by Indigenous Peoples (First Nations, Métis, Inuit), Black communities and People of Colour, women, LGBT2Q+ and immigrant communities.
